Italian Corti a Ponte hosting Iranian ‘Am I a Wolf?’

Iranian animation ‘Am I a Wolf?’ is competing at the 2020 Corti a Ponte filmfest in Italy.

The 13th Corti a Ponte international film festival in Italy has been hosting the Iranian animation ‘Am I a Wolf?’.

Directed by Amir-Houshang Moeen and based on a fantasy book by Afsaneh Shabannejad, ‘Am I a Wolf?’ is a recreation of the classic fable titled ‘The Wolf and the Lamb’.

In the short animation, a number of students are performing a theater titled ‘The Wolf and the Seven Little Goats’. Everybody has a role.

They are totally getting carried away by their roles in a way that the border between reality and theatrical performance is now hardly realized.

Meanwhile, the child acting as the wolf in the story is scripted to be defeated. That makes him feel lonely and annoyed.

As he takes his role too seriously, a bit of chaos startles the group. In the end, the presence of other children and his friends next to him take him out of this mood.

The animation has gone on screen at several global events, including the annual World Festival of Animated Film Zagreb in Croatia, the Annecy International Animation Film Festival in France, and the International Leipzig Festival for Documentary and Animated Film in Germany.

Corti a Ponte festival is a unique event in Italy that dedicates a large international section to children and young people.

The event hosts short films made by children from around the world. The films are selected based on their quality and cultural value.

The 13th edition of the Italian festival is taking place from October 31 to November 7, 2020.
